Output d90162d4e38e8ac04f267e4c0a8bb7c1dc0941f669f424a648a077f5aaf57980:79

value
149362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8058b974bc18183b2a8b9011a2a46f1018e9f1a4 OP_EQUAL
address
3DPehnCJQ1ztZwLBWiEDSQzwiMXjVJfb4d
transaction
d90162d4e38e8ac04f267e4c0a8bb7c1dc0941f669f424a648a077f5aaf57980